It will be with a dedicated concert At the origins of bel canto that will start, Tuesday 7 May 2024 at 8.30 pmthe programming of the first edition of Modena Belcanto Festival, the event that takes up the baton of Modena City of Belcanto, promoted by the Municipality of Modena, the Teatro Comunale Foundation, the Modena Foundation and the Vecchi-Tonelli Conservatory. The inaugural event – ​​scheduled in the Church of Sant’Agostino in Modena – is created in collaboration with Grandezze&Meraviglie – Associazione Musicale Estense and will bring to light unpublished scores preserved in the Estense Library: the interpretation of these pages will be entrusted to the Violin Companywith Alessandro Ciccolini in the double role of violin soloist and director and with the participation of the soprano’s solo voice Monica Piccinini.

«The culture of singing – explains director Alessandro Ciccolini – has always been a protagonist in Modena. Since the dawn of melodrama, the Este court has recognized and supported the importance of musical performances. This concert will be a journey to rediscover a religious theater steeped in chiaroscuro and full of moments of refreshment for the human soul.”

At the origins of bel canto. Sacred female faces at the court of Francis II – this is the full title of the concert – will propose in particular a program of music by Antonio Gianettini (1649-1721), Alessandro Scarlatti (1660-1725) and Giovanni Bononcini (1670-1747) dedicated to the sacred female figures who were exalted in music during the historical period, very fruitful, dominated by the figure of Francesco II d’Este. A lover of music from an early age, Francesco II d’Este is in fact an emblematic figure of the second half of the seventeenth century, precisely because of the great attention he dedicated to music throughout his reign. This great passion made Modena a prominent musical center thanks to the presence of the best composers of the time. In those years there were numerous concerts, operas and oratorios composed for the ducal court. And the strong religious vocation of the Este court found a perfect union with the music and singing of the orators: through the arias and symphonies of these orators an idea of ​​sacred theater was proposed which was the paradigm of a model that found diffusion throughout Europe .
